Abstract
Disclosed is a logistic control system. An RFID electronic tag, a GPRS, a GPS and an IC card are adopted in the system to carry out whole monitoring on important cargos. The system comprises a logistic data movable terminal and a base control center, wherein the logistic data movable terminal is arranged at a cargo in (out)-warehouse position and a transportation vehicle, obtains position information through the GPS and sends the position information to the base control center in real time through the GPRS, and the base control center transmits data to a logistic control center data base through the internet.

Embodiment
Be described further below in conjunction with drawings and Examples.
As shown in Figure 1, a kind of logistics control system, this system adopts RFID electronic tag, GPRS, GPS and IC-card that Very Important Cargo is carried out complete monitoring, this system comprises: the mobile logistics data terminal, be installed in advancing on place, (going out) storehouse and the transportation lorry of goods, obtain positional information by GPS, send positional information to base control center in real time by GPRS; Base control center, by the Internet with data transfer to logistics control center database.
The mobile logistics data terminal is comprised of central controller and RFID recognition module, GPS receiver module, IC-card identification module, GPRS module, electronic tag recognition device: distribute an electronic tag on each goods, the information of carrying on the electronic tag has uniqueness, when goods enters or during outbound and in transportation, electronic tag recognition device reads the data on the label by antenna, the information recording/of goods is got off, utilize the GPRS short message service to pass to long distance control system; The GPS locating device: the function of GPS locating device is the particular location that calculates goods by receiving satellite signal, and this is the basic data of the complete monitoring of goods; The IC-card identification module: the IC-card identification module is mainly finished the authentication to the operating personnel's of goods identity and authority, and the record of Operation Log.The personnel that requirement operates goods must have clear and definite identity and legal authority, the complete monitoring of special cargo comprised from the goods registration, goes out put, detrains, escorts on the way etc., as the disabled user or the user who does not possess authority when operating by force goods (stealing event such as train), to produce Realtime Alerts information, the operation of validated user will be recorded time, the action type information of operation; The GPRS module: the GPRS module of system is utilized mobile module and SIM card, carries out the transmission of short message, and the short message of transmission comprises the register information of goods, conveying people, gets on or off the bus, positional information, warning message etc.
In the control center of base, GPRS communication processor, GPRS communication processor are responsible for receiving the short message that each goods is sent, and by the Internet data are passed to control center; Base control center management system, the architecture that base control center management system has adopted client/server and browser/server structure to combine.The B/S structure division provides the layman to carry out information inquiry by INTERNET or INTRENET network.For making the more hommization of network inquiry system, B/S infrastructure software front-end interface has adopted Geographic Information System, various data messages are placed on the map, when goods is constantly sent locating information here, the position of goods on map releases various information by WEB server and GIS publisher server also in continuous change.The main completing user of C/S structure division is managed, is blocked the system maintenance functions such as management, equipment control, management of blueprint, geographical information management, finishes simultaneously the function of assigning of control command, and client is placed on Surveillance center, and each feature operation has the restriction of authority.
The mobile logistics data terminal is carried out the following step:
(1) system reads RFID, if signal is arranged, the data that receive goods are preserved;
(2) read IC-card data and pass to the base by GPRS, with checking goods handling people's identity;
(3) some special goods, need to implement multiple check, comprise and need competent authorities' IC-card signature etc., when goods in transportation, if run into special circumstances, such as robbery, when raw material is revealed, the driver can press EmS, state of goods can be known the very first time by base control center, automatically reports to departments at different levels and carries out emergency treatment.
